초록
It is important for vehicle drivers to obtain useful information through systems such as a global positioning system (GPS), an intelligent transportation system (ITS), or WiFi data communication. Communication over long distances can be beneficial in many ways. In this paper, an RF link budget calculation for a long range WiFi communication service based on multi-hop communication was introduced, and breakpoint distance and Fresnel zone were calculated to determine the appropriate height of antennas of WiFi repeaters. In addition, this paper demonstrates a received signal strength indicator (RSSI) circuit employed to find the strongest received signal from multiple directions.
